What does a community support associate do?

A Community Support Associate provides assistance and resources to individuals within a community, often helping them access services, resolve issues, and improve their overall well-being. They may work with diverse populations, including families, the elderly, or people with disabilities, to offer guidance, advocacy, and support. Their responsibilities can include answering questions, connecting people with local programs, and facilitating communication between community members and service providers. The goal is to empower individuals and strengthen the community as a whole.

How does a community support associate typically collaborate with other departments to resolve member issues?

Community Support Associates often work closely with teams like product, engineering, and marketing to address member concerns efficiently. When a technical issue arises, they may escalate tickets to the engineering team and provide detailed feedback to ensure swift resolution. Regular cross-department meetings or updates help keep everyone aligned on recurring community concerns or feature requests. This collaborative approach not only enhances the member experience but also gives associates insight into broader company operations, which can be valuable for career development.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a community support associ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Community Support Associate, you typically need a background in social work, psychology, or a related field, along with strong interpersonal and problem-solving skills. Familiarity with client management software, documentation systems, and sometimes certifications in mental health or crisis intervention are valuable. Outstanding communication, patience, and cultural sensitivity enable you to connect with diverse clients and respond effectively to their needs. These skills and qualities are crucial for providing meaningful support and facilitating positive outcomes for individuals in the community.

Job description

Overview
Practice Support Associate
Catholic Health Physician Practices
Catholic Health is looking for a reliable and organized Practice Support Associate to support the daily operations of our physician offices. This front-line role ensures smooth patient flow and provides outstanding service both in-person and over the phone.
Job Details
Job Responsibilities:
  • Answer phones and schedule patient appointments
  • Prepare charts and handle physician correspondence
  • Verify insurance, obtain referrals and authorizations
  • Assist patients with check-in, forms, and general questions
  • Ensure timely and accurate administrative support to clinical staff

Job Requirements:
  • High school diploma or GED required; Associate's degree or healthcare-related training preferred
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ook)
  • Strong communication and multitasking skills
  • Knowledge of medical terminology a plus
  • Comfortable using and troubleshooting basic office equipment

Formed in 1998 under four religious sponsors, Catholic Health in Buffalo, NY is a non-profit healthcare system that provides care to Western New Yorkers across a network of hospitals, nursing homes, home care agencies, physician practices, and other community based ministries. Today, the system has two religious sponsors, the Diocese of Buffalo and the Franciscan Sisters of St. Joseph, who carried on its Mission across the Buffalo-Niagara region. Our mission sets us apart. It's the human side of healthcare – the touch, smile or comforting word that can help make your healthcare experience better. It's treating all people with respect and dignity, and providing comfort in times of greatest need. Catholic Health is making the largest investment in its history, dedicating more than $100 million in state-of-the- art technology that will connect our hospitals, home care, long-term care, clinician offices, health centers and ancillary services with patients throughout the area. This transformational investment marks a major milestone for our healing ministry, which dates back more than 165 years.
